I still haven't decided, but here's some info I dug up in case it helps anyone else:Alexander - He's basically had 3 bad games all year (low yardage and no scores). Week 2 at Tampa when his knee was bothering him. And, Seattle losses in Week 7 at Arizona and Week 12 vs Buffalo. In both cases, Seattle was behind most of the game and couldn't get anything going on offense - result 12-13 carries for Alexander. I think the big question here is, will Seattle be behind and/or lose to the Jets?K. Jones - One of my concerns was I had an impression that he didn't get featured as much in the 2nd half. When I looked at the numbers, this isn't really true. I think Mooch is feeding this guy just fine. Sure, when they were way down against Indy, he disappeared, but so would any running game (Detroit lost 41-9). And, he didn't do much in the 2nd half against Minnesota the first time - when you look at the game log, Minnesota had 2 really long, clock-killing drives in the 2nd half (came from behind and beat Detroit 22-19). So, he is being featured, but did the Vikings figure something out about the Lions in that 2nd half and does that spell trouble for Jones this week?Pittman - He puts up nice stat lines, but he does it in the weirdest ways. One week, its his rushing numbers, the next, his receiving. Why is that? Cause Gruden just loves this guy and does whatever he can to get him touches. He had a bad week last week against a tough defense, but now he gets a cupcake. In fact his 3 "bad" games (looking only at the last 7) came against San Diego and Atlanta twice. He seems to struggle against solid defenses and "go off" against weak ones. Enter the Saints...Bottom line, all of these guys get the touches to produce and have the skills to take advantage.
